“Nice Hotel. Reasonably priced. Had a standard room with ocean view. It's on the smaller size but well equipped. There are a lot of little touches and amenities you will find in a boutique hotel. It reminds me of European hotels. The balcony is small, but they have a rooftop terrace that is really nice and well equipped with cushions and seating if you want to spend time just looking at the view which is amazing from there. Servicing a continental breakfast was a nice touch that few hotels offer here. We took our breakfast to the rooftop terrace and had a lovely time. All the employees we encountered were very nice and accommodating if we had a question or request. I will stay there again and would recommend.”

“Currently day dreaming of Catalina Island and my visit here in late August. After much research I opted to stay one night in Hotel Vista Del Mar when visiting the island for a short 24 hour trip. The location of the hotel is central, making it accessible to countless restaurants and nearby shops. The aesthetic of the hotel is lovely and the rooms are comfortable and clean despite the size. While the hotel is on the smaller side and on a main tourist heavy street there was no issue with noise or privacy. The hotel felt safe and was overall easily accessible despite the lack of an elevator. Staff were friendly and check in and check out was smooth. I found no fault in our stay here and I'll be returning soon!”
